
Stew is the ultimate cold weather food. So to keep you warm I am sharing this recipe with you. In this recipe I have included butter beans which are packed with protein, fibre, and other nutrients, making them a super food. In addition to that I have potatoes and carrots which rounds off this meal perfectly. The recipe is as follow:
Preparation: 10 mins Cooking time: 20min - 30min Serves 4 Ingredients A dash of oil 2 cups (250ml+250ml) leaks finely sliced 1 cup (250ml) celery stalks finely sliced 1 tbsp (15ml) fresh garlic paste 1 cup (250ml) carrots cubed 1-2 red/green chilli torn into pieces 2 medium potatoes cut into small cubes 1 cup chopped canned tomatoes 1 tbsp (15ml) veg stock powder (ina paarman's) ½ tbsp (7.5ml) garlic powder ½ tbsp (7.5ml) onion powder 3 cups (750ml) boiling water 2 can butter beans (strain brine) ½ cup fresh parsley
Let’s Cook:-) Heat oil in a big pot Toss in leeks, celery, garlic and carrots. Give it a good stir. Add chillies, and cook for 5 mins Throw in the potatoes, tomatoes, veg stock powder as well as garlic and onion powder - give it a good stir - cover and cook for 5-8 mins Pour in boiling water Add butter beans - give it a good stir. Cover and cook for 10-15 mins stirring from time to time. When the gravy thickens, toss in parsley leaves and simmer for a minute. Serve with toasted garlic bread. Hot tips: add more or less water, according to the gravy consistency you desire.
